1FPR
CRYSTAL STRUCTURE OF THE COMPLEX FORMED BETWEEN THE CATALYTIC DOMAIN OF SHP-1 AND AN IN VITRO PEPTIDE SUBSTRATE PY469 DERIVED FROM SHPS-1.
Summary for 1FPR
Entry DOI | 10.2210/pdb1fpr/pdb |
Descriptor | PROTEIN-TYROSINE PHOSPHATASE 1C, PEPTIDE PY469 (2 entities in total) |
Functional Keywords | protein tyrosine phosphatase, substrate specificity, residue shift, signaling protein |
Biological source | Homo sapiens (human) More |
Cellular location | Cytoplasm: P29350 |
Total number of polymer chains | 2 |
Total formula weight | 33793.93 |
Authors | Yang, J.,Cheng, Z.,Niu, Z.,Zhao, Z.J.,Zhou, G.W. (deposition date: 2000-08-31, release date: 2001-03-07, Last modification date: 2021-11-03) |
Primary citation | Yang, J.,Cheng, Z.,Niu, T.,Liang, X.,Zhao, Z.J.,Zhou, G.W. Structural basis for substrate specificity of protein-tyrosine phosphatase SHP-1. J.Biol.Chem., 275:4066-4071, 2000 Cited by PubMed: 10660565DOI: 10.1074/jbc.275.6.4066 PDB entries with the same primary citation |
Experimental method | X-RAY DIFFRACTION (2.5 Å) |
